Colonial Theatre 

The Boys Next Door
July 23, 24, 30, 31 @ 8pm
August 1 @ 2pm

This very funny, very touching play focuses on the lives of four mentally challenged men who live in a communal residence: Norman (John Locke,) a mentally handicapped man, growing increasingly unhealthy through the sweet temptations he works around every day; Lucien (Corey Nulton,) severely handicapped and thoroughly helpless, who takes great pride in the large tomes he pretends to understand; Barry (Christopher Hutter,) a schizophrenic suffering as much from grand delusions as from the memory of an abusive father; and Arnold (Jack Lefebvre) a mentally-challenged manic-depressive who is as paranoid as he is bossy and uncompromising. Their sincere, but increasingly burned-out social worker, Jack (Josh Antoon,) is faced with the ever present strain of dealing with their issues and dilemmas while his dedication suffers. Mingled with scenes from the daily lives of these four, where "little things" sometimes become momentous, are moments of great poignancy. With touching effectiveness, we are reminded that these men, like the rest of us, want only to love, laugh, and find some meaning and purpose in the time that they are allotted on this earth.
